Indian education: What works, what doesn't, and how to navigate it

When we talk about Indian education, the system that shapes millions of students through board exams, coaching centers, and digital tools. Also known as school and college education in India, it's not just about textbooks—it's about survival, strategy, and sometimes, sheer grit. This isn't a system designed for comfort. It's built for competition. From the moment a child sits for their first board exam, they’re stepping into a structure that values results over rhythm, rankings over curiosity, and resilience over reassurance.

At the heart of this system are CBSE schools, the most widespread board in India, aligned with national entrance exams like JEE and NEET. Also known as Central Board of Secondary Education, it’s the default choice for families aiming for engineering or medicine. But CBSE isn’t the whole story. Behind every success story is a student who didn’t just follow the syllabus—they hacked it. They used e-learning platforms, digital tools like YouTube, Coursera, and Google Classroom that turned passive learning into active practice. Also known as online learning systems, these platforms became the real classroom for students in small towns with no coaching centers nearby.

And then there’s the pressure cooker: competitive exams, high-stakes tests like IIT JEE, NEET, and UPSC that decide careers before age 20. Also known as entrance exams, they’re not just tests—they’re gauntlets. Thousands train for months, sometimes years, using apps, mock papers, and late-night study sessions. The winners aren’t always the smartest. They’re the most consistent. The ones who showed up every day, even when motivation vanished. This isn’t theory.
